Man shoots at another vehicle during road rage incident in Tate Township

TATE TOWNSHIP, Ohio — A 35-year-old man faces felonious assault charges after allegedly shooting at another vehicle in a road rage incident in Clermont County. Miles Phillip Popp was arrested around midnight in Brown County and is being held on a $500,000 cash/surety bond.

The Clermont County Sheriff’s Office responded to a 911 call at 7:39 p.m. Monday near East Plane Street and Starling Road. The victim reported attempting to pass Popp’s vehicle when he heard three loud noises and felt debris strike his neck and face, caused by shattered glass from a rearview mirror hit by an unknown object. The victim was unharmed.

Deputies apprehended Popp on Locust Ridge New Harmony Road in Pike Township. He admitted to firing one gunshot from his vehicle, and a loaded gun was found in his vehicle’s glove box during a search. The incident remains under investigation.
